Fayerweather Management is an investment management firm that manages three pooled investment vehicles called Private Funds. Fayerweather makes all investment decisions for these funds. Investors in the Private Funds are advised of the investment strategy before investing and generally cannot impose unique restrictions on their investments. The firm does not participate in wrap fee programs.
Fayerweather Management charges asset-based management fees and performance-based fees to the Private Funds it manages.
For Fund 1, the management fee is 0.25% per year of the total capital commitments, paid quarterly in advance. Fayerweather also receives 10% of the cumulative distributions exceeding the total capital contributions.
For Fund Eiger, the management fee is 0.15% per year of the total initial capital contribution amounts, paid quarterly in advance. Fayerweather also receives 5% of the cumulative distributions exceeding the total capital contributions.
Management fees may be offset by certain fees paid to Fayerweather or its affiliates.
